Course Delivery Methods
Classroom-Based
Students meet routinely in a classroom, laboratory or other scheduled campus or community facility. Classroom-based courses meet in-person on a regular schedule and may use online resources and e-learning to accompany and supplement the mode of instruction.
Online
These courses are offered completely online without required in-person interaction with the instructor or class. Online courses may be offered synchronously, asynchronously, or as a combination of both.
Hybrid
These courses meet online and in-person with regular weekly in-person meetings.
Merged
Students in an online section of a course may be merged with a classroom-based section of the same course for enrollment purposes when both sections are taught by the same instructor. Students in merged sections are viewed to be in the same course and use online resources and e-learning jointly to accompany and supplement the mode of instruction.
